- The distance between Ushuaia, Argentina and Matsuyama, Japan is approximately 17,168 km or 10,668 mi.
- To reach Ushuaia in this distance one would set out from Matsuyama bearing 151.3° or SSE and follow the great circles arc to approach Ushuaia bearing 43.8° or NE .
- Ushuaia has a tundra climate (ET) whereas Matsuyama has a humid subtropical climate (Cfa).
- Ushuaia is in or near the boreal moist forest biome whereas Matsuyama is in or near the warm temperate moist forest biome.
- The average annual temperature is 10 °C (18°F) cooler.
- Average monthly temperatures vary by 13.6 °C (24.5°F) less in Ushuaia. The continentality subtype is barely hyperoceanic as opposed to subcontinental.
- Total annual precipitation averages 756.4 mm (29.8 in) less which is equivalent to 756.4 l/m² (18.56 US gal/ft²) or 7,564,000 l/ha (808,642 US gal/ac) less. About 2/5 as much.
- The altitude of the sun at midday is overall 21.5° lower in Ushuaia than in Matsuyama.
- Relative humidity levels are 8.5% higher.
- The mean dew point temperature is 8.1°C (14.6°F) lower.
